How the Ticketing Phases Will Work
The ticket-selling process will be broken up into several stages to ensure fairness and accessibility. Here's what fans need to know:
- Phase 1: Starts September 2024. Fans can apply for tickets through a lottery system.
- Phase 2: Launch date to be announced. Likely includes “First Come, First Served” purchases.
- Phase 3: Last-minute sales near the tournament kickoff for remaining tickets.
Ticket availability will span individual matches, team-specific passes, venue packages, and hospitality suites, giving options for every level of fandom and budget.
Massive Interest Expected for North America’s First Joint World Cup
The 2026 edition of the World Cup is notable for being co-hosted by the United States, Mexico, and Canada. Not only is this the first time three countries will host simultaneously, but the tournament will also expand from 32 to 48 teams for the first time in FIFA history.
Anticipation is especially high in the U.S., where matches will take place in major cities such as:
- Atlanta
- Los Angeles
- Miami
- Dallas
- New York/New Jersey
- San Francisco Bay Area
How to Prepare for Ticket Applications
Fans are encouraged to register for FIFA’s ticketing portal ahead of the opening phase in September. Doing so ensures users receive timely updates and eligibility for early access options.
Given the immense demand and the historic nature of the 2026 World Cup, FIFA anticipates a record number of applications during the sales phases. It’s highly recommended to apply as early as possible once your desired phase opens.
